STS-87 - 88th launch of the space shuttle under the Space Shuttle program and the 24th Columbia space flight, made on November 19, 1997 . Astronauts spent about 16 days in space and landed safely in Kennedy CC on December 5, 1997 .

The launch into orbit and the return to Earth of the scientific satellite SPARTAN-201-4 [2] . Scientific experiments [3] .
Crew
(NASA) : Kevin Kregel (3) [4] - commander;
(NASA): Stephen Lindsay (1) - pilot;
(NASA): Winston Scott (2) - Flight Specialist 1;
(NASA): Kalpana Chawla (1) - Flight Specialist 2;
( JAXA ): Takao Doi (1) - Flight Specialist 3;
( GKAU ): Leonid Kadeniuk (1) - payload specialist .
